The Nicolas Darvas story is a fascinating tale of how a dancer turned into a legendary trader using a unique technical indicator method known as the ‘Darvas Box’ theory. His approach to trading, which he famously chronicled in his book “How I Made $2,000,000 in the Stock Market,” remains a topic of study and inspiration for traders worldwide. Darvas’ method was based on self-taught principles that combined technical analysis with a fundamental understanding of the stock market.

The Darvas Box Theory

Nicolas Darvas developed the Darvas Box theory, a method for tracking stock movements that helped him identify profitable trading opportunities.

Understanding the Darvas Box

The Darvas Box method involves drawing boxes around stock price consolidations or ranges. Darvas looked for stocks trading in a narrow price range, which he interpreted as a period of accumulation by smart money. When the stock price broke out of this range (box) on good volume, he considered it a buy signal, expecting the stock to move higher.

Trading Strategy

Darvas’ strategy was to buy when a stock moved above the box and sell when it fell below the box. He set a stop-loss just under the box to minimize potential losses. This approach allowed him to capitalize on significant upward price movements while limiting his downside risk.

Nicolas Darvas’ Trading Philosophy

Nicolas Darvas’ success wasn’t just due to his technical method; it was also a result of his disciplined trading philosophy.

Importance of Discipline and Psychology

Darvas emphasized the importance of discipline and psychological resilience in trading. He strictly adhered to his buy and sell rules, avoiding emotional decision-making. His ability to stick to his strategy, even in the face of market volatility, was a key factor in his success.

Self-Taught, Independent Approach

Darvas’ approach was unique because he was largely self-taught and did not rely heavily on the advice of others. He believed in doing his own research and staying independent in his decision-making process, a principle that resonated with many individual traders.

The Legacy of Nicolas Darvas

Nicolas Darvas left a lasting legacy in the world of trading, inspiring generations of traders with his innovative approach and remarkable success story.

Influence on Technical Analysis

Darvas’ box theory contributed significantly to technical analysis, providing a systematic and visual method for identifying potential breakouts in stock prices. His approach is still used by traders today as part of their technical analysis toolkit.

Inspiration for Traders

Darvas’ story continues to inspire traders, showing that with discipline, a sound method, and a willingness to learn, successful trading is achievable. His approach to the market, combining technical analysis with a strong trading philosophy, remains relevant and influential in today’s trading world.
